Transaction 671ee62438eb268deeb3eaf30a4af287714ccadfe623bb4a6e3ce19e94b0de73

1 Input
2 Outputs
  • 671ee62438eb268deeb3eaf30a4af287714ccadfe623bb4a6e3ce19e94b0de73:0
  • value  97626
    address  3CowhmNHcsrXqdsuVtWbJyxzoEZhk18EeK
  • 671ee62438eb268deeb3eaf30a4af287714ccadfe623bb4a6e3ce19e94b0de73:1
  • value  1066561
    address  bc1q9dzfys9xc5came2elude66p8qvchh2c2ua2dwx